There’s something unmistakably special about the way western Christmas ornaments bring the spirit of the season to life. For those who cherish the rugged beauty of the frontier, these unique decorations capture the essence of cowboy culture and infuse it into holiday traditions. Whether you’re decking the halls of a ranch house, a cozy cabin, or a city apartment that longs for wide-open skies, western ornaments offer a way to celebrate the holidays with a touch of the Old West. These pieces often feature iconic imagery—think miniature cowboy boots, horseshoes, lassos, and hats—each one a nod to the timeless traditions of the American West. The craftsmanship and detail found in these ornaments can turn any tree into a tribute to the cowboy way of life, with every glimmering light reflecting the warmth of a campfire and the camaraderie of a trail ride. Western Christmas decor isn’t just about aesthetics; it’s about storytelling, passing down memories, and sharing a love for a lifestyle defined by adventure, resilience, and a deep connection to the land.
